Fender Introduces 800-Watt Bassman Head
Amps

Fender Introduces 800-Watt Bassman Head

Fender’s Bassman series of bass amplifiers has gotten bigger with the introduction of the Bassman 800 Head. The 800-watt, dual channel amp features a hybrid design with a tube preamp matched to a Class D power section. It weighs 17 pounds. Its two-channel tube preamp has Vintage and Overdrive voicings. Radial Engineering Revamps Bigshot i/o
Pedals & Effects

Radial Engineering Revamps Bigshot i/o

After introducing the EFX version earlier this year, Radial is continuing to work on its Bigshot pedal series with a new redesign of the Bigshot i/o. The stompbox is a instrument selector that allows for switching between two basses plugged into the same amp. Each input can be selected quickly via footswitch.
